Job Description

Master's degree in Speech-Language Pathology, active SLP license and 1+ year of Speech-Language Pathology experience required. Applicants who do not meet these qualifications will not be considered. A welcoming school district near Brandon, Florida is hiring a Speech-Language Pathologist for the upcoming school year. This onsite position offers the chance to support K-12 students in a collaborative educational setting while making a meaningful impact on communication development.
Position Details:
Full-time, contract position K-12 caseload within a school-based environment Onsite role for the school year Interviewing now for quick placement
What You'll Do:
Evaluate students with speech, language, and communication disorders Develop and implement individualized treatment plans aligned with IEP goals Provide direct therapy services and monitor student progress Collaborate with educators, families, and support staff Maintain compliant documentation and reports
Requirements:
Active Florida Speech-Language Pathologist license ASHA certification (CCC-SLP) preferred Previous school or pediatric experience is a plus Strong communication and teamwork skills
